When teams manage sensitive systems, version control isn’t just about clean history. It’s about staying aligned with strict regulatory frameworks. One wrong revert, one overlooked reset, and suddenly you’re out of compliance with data retention laws, audit controls, or industry mandates. That’s where mastering git reset within a regulatory alignment process becomes mission-critical.
Git Reset Without Riskgit reset is powerful. It rewrites history. In regulated environments, rewriting history isn’t forbidden, but it must be controlled. Blindly resetting can erase records that are legally required to remain discoverable. The goal is not to stop using git reset, but to use it safely within a process that preserves compliance. This means understanding which reset modes (soft, mixed, hard) can be applied, when to avoid them, and when an alternate strategy—like git revert—is safer.
Regulatory Alignment as Part of Workflow
To align your reset workflow with compliance, start with an auditable pipeline. Track every commit change, even when resetting. Use server-side hooks or CI checks to reject unsafe changes to main branches. Mirror your repository to a secure, write-once store for immutable commit logs. Map your version control practices directly to clauses in your regulatory framework so that every reset action has a documented safeguard.
Bridging Engineering and Compliance
A reset command isn’t just a developer decision—it’s a compliance event. Coordination between engineers, compliance officers, and security teams ensures changes are reversible, documented, and instantly traceable. Whether you handle HIPAA, SOC 2, GDPR, or ISO standards, the principle is the same: a git reset must never create an unfillable audit gap.